Magellan Health Services
Overview
Magellan Health Services is a specialty healthcare service provider that focuses on complex and costly healthcare services; including behavioral health, Medicaid administration, radiology benefits management and specialty pharmacy management. Their corporate headquarters, formerly in Farmington, Connecticut have recently moved to Avon, Connecticut.
With a customer base of over 52 million patients, Magellan is currently a Fortune 1000 organization. Rene Lerer, the current Chief Executive Officer led the company to an annual $1 billion in revenue for fiscal year 2011. Magellan is also a top provider of affordable healthcare for veterans and their families.
Magellan Health Services Job Information
Magellan currently employs 5,000 individuals located throughout the United States. Benefits offered to employees include a consumer-driven health plan (CDHP) with a healthcare reimbursement fund (HRF), high deductible with health savings account (HAS), preferred provider organization (PPO), exclusive provider organization (EPO), dental plan, vision care plan and behavioral health and substance abuse services through Magellan LifeResource. Magellan also offers an excellent 401 (k) retirement account for those who are interested, with a fifty percent company match. Employees are also offered the opportunity to take paid time off to volunteer for charities in their local communities.
Clinical Officer is the highest paying job at Magellan Health Services at $125,000 annually.
